Compact junior playground at Linsley Street Reserve, Box Hill

The project brief from the City of Whitehorse was simple - 'tidy up this pocket-park'

The Linsley Street Reserve playground is nestled between a car park and road, adjacent to a walkway, opposite the railway line, at the rear of the Box Hill Library. It called for a compact, bright and happy play structure, suitable for young children.

The result was a small play structure with a number of climbing and sliding play activities including a curved slide and mountain climber as well as a contemporary curved roof. The play structure continues to keep young children interested and occupied on the way to or from the library.
